Why melting ice sheets and glaciers are affecting people thousands of miles away
View
Date:2025-04-16 20:26:53
The world's massive ice sheets and glaciers are melting as climate change raises temperatures. Scientists warn that disappearing ice is having surprising and far-reaching effects.
